"There is no such thing as a money problem in marriage." Financial expert Ron Blue and his wife, Judy, insist that marital problems are never about money. But they're often about communication, particularly when it comes to the thorny issue of finances. Marriage after broken marriage testifies to just how charged the topic of money can be, and how important it is for husbands and wives to know how to discuss it with one another. In Money Talks and So Can We, the Blues help you and your mate communicate openly and honestly about the vital topic of managing your money. This is not just a book on family financial planning. It's about how to operate as a team, overcoming your individual weaknesses and uniting your strengths to cultivate vision and prosperity in your marriage. In Part One, the Blues help you bridge the financial communication gap. You'll consider the purpose of money and marriage, get a crash course on effective communication, and learn how to put together a truly enjoyable planning weekend. In Part Two, you'll learn how to combine your efforts to handle some essential monetary priorities, from the basics of developing a budget, to getting out of debt, to investing wisely, to creating a will, to the pros and cons of a dual-income household, to the challenges and rewards of giving, and more. Money Talks and So Can We will help you and your mate work as partners on the critical area of finances. Together, you can sow the seeds of security for your future, and enjoy today the benefits not only of financial stability, but of deepened trust and fruitfulness in your marriage.
Author Biography: Ron Blue is founder and president of Ronald Blue Co., which offers financialand investment counsel, estate and retirement planning, tax business services, and assistance with charitable giving strategies, wealth transference, and related areas. He is author of nine books, including Generous Living, Master Your Money, and Taming the Money Monster.;Jodie Berndt is the author of several books, including Celebration of Miracles and Generous Living (with Ron Blue). Her background also includes television writing, producing, and on-camera reporting with the 700 Club. She has four children and leads a weekly Moms-in-Touch prayer group for mothers of school-age children. She and her family recently moved to Coronado, CA.;Judy Blue has spent 22 years teaching and discipling women, including five years as the leader of a weekly Bible study for nearly 100 young mothers. She is coauthor with Ron of Raising Money-Smart Kids. The Blues live in Atlanta, GA. They have five children and four grandchildren.
